Having the Nexus line of phones is VERY similar to having an Iphone. Since the company that does the OS also does the phone, you get pure stock greatness. The updates come first and unhindered by brands like Samsung and ATT. You don't have to wait at all. You will get monthly security updates. Once you are tired of the way it looks or handles, you can Root and mess with the kernel (very very easy stuff to do).

Samsung phones were the best phones for awhile to a large section of the USA because that was the best you could get on Verizon.

The first Nexus phone to come to Verizon was an absolute shite show and it was also a Samsung, lol. The next iteration of Nexus didn't even come to Verizon due to the Galaxy Nexus failure. Verizon has made life hell for most Android phones and a massive reason why the iphone has thrived there. Apple deserves massive thanks from Verizon users for what it did to Big Red in regards to OS updates. No one else could of taken that stand to tell Big Red to go frick itself at that point in history over OS updates and bloatware and won. Hell Samsung still hasn't done it for whatever reason.
